91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何解決mysql大表查詢慢的問題

發布時間:2020-11-04 10:08:58 來源:億速云 閱讀:1363 作者:小新 欄目:MySQL數據庫

小編給大家分享一下如何解決mysql大表查詢慢的問題,希望大家閱讀完這篇文章后大所收獲,下面讓我們一起去探討吧!

mysql大表查詢慢的優化方法:1、合理建立索引,通常查詢利用到索引比不用索引更快;2、對關鍵字段建立水平分區,比如時間字段,若查詢條件往往通過時間范圍來進行查詢,能提升不少性能;3、建立粗粒度數據表;4、利用緩存。

mysql數據庫表太大查詢慢優化

1、合理建立索引

通常查詢利用到索引比不用索引更快,通過explain 可查看索引是否被使用.具體explain使用方法,如

http://www.cnitblog.com/aliyiyi08/archive/2008/09/09/48878.html

當查詢包含group by時 而group by字段屬于索引字段時,如果查詢結果不能通過group by松散或緊湊索引而決定,group by操作就會建立臨時表根據文件排序(Using temporary; Using filesort)來得到結果,往往性能更低,但也不是絕對的,即使利用到了索引也不一定比沒用到查詢更快。

2、建立分區

對關鍵字段建立水平分區,比如時間字段,若查詢條件往往通過時間范圍來進行查詢,能提升不少性能。

3、建立粗粒度數據表

根據查詢建立對應的表,定時對重復的記錄進行壓縮轉存至新表,粒度變大,數據記錄變少。

4、利用緩存

利用緩存將一次查詢“得來不易”的數據緩存住一段時間,從而提高效率。

看完了這篇文章,相信你對如何解決mysql大表查詢慢的問題有了一定的了解,想了解更多相關知識,歡迎關注億速云行業資訊頻道,感謝各位的閱讀!

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

宜川县| 海门市| 双桥区| 南岸区| 河西区| 沂水县| 什邡市| 深水埗区| 平定县| 乐业县| 陈巴尔虎旗| 永康市| 屯门区| 石渠县| 兴和县| 横山县| 宿松县| 鄯善县| 石首市| 西贡区| 汤原县| 江津市| 巴青县| 左权县| 珲春市| 肇州县| 即墨市| 浠水县| 尉犁县| 山丹县| 游戏| 津南区| 隆林| 两当县| 通渭县| 蒙山县| 正阳县| 孝感市| 苗栗县| 乌海市| 营山县|